A CONCURRENT RESOLUTION
TO COMMEND AND CONGRATULATE THE AIKEN TECHNICAL COLLEGE KNIGHTS BASKETBALL TEAM OF AIKEN COUNTY ON ITS OUTSTANDING SEASON, ON CAPTURING THE NATIONAL JUNIOR COLLEGE ATHLETIC ASSOCIATION DIVISION II REGION 10 AND DISTRICT 7 CHAMPIONSHIPS, AND ON RECEIVING AN INVITATION TO COMPETE IN THE NATIONAL JUNIOR COLLEGE ATHLETIC ASSOCIATION DIVISION II NATIONAL TOURNAMENT.
Whereas, under the leadership of Charles Welch, the Aiken Technical College Knights Basketball Team has had an outstanding 1999-2000 season, which has been punctuated by winning both the 2000 National Junior College Athletic Association Division II Region 10 Championship and the National Junior College Athletic Association Division II District 7 Championship; and
Whereas, these achievements have secured the Aiken Technical College Knights Basketball Team a berth in the National Junior College Athletic Association Division II National Tournament in Danville, Illinois; and
Whereas, the Knights have compiled a superb record of thirty wins and one loss thus far on its march toward a national championship; and
Whereas, the following members of the basketball team have been selected to the National Junior College Athletic Association Division II All Region 10 Team: Lemaas Barfield - First Team; Tuffy Walker - First Team; Deon Mealing - Second Team; Broderick Marshall - Second Team; Kenny Dukes - Honorable Mention; Janar Quiller - Honorable Mention; and James Harris - Honorable Mention; and
Whereas, Coach Welch's superior coaching talents have earned him the National Junior College Athletic Association Division II Region 10 and District 7 Coach of the Year Awards; and
Whereas, by their individual and collective achievements, the Aiken Technical College Knights Basketball Team and its coaching staff have brought national attention and the national spotlight to Aiken Technical College, Aiken County, and the entire State of South Carolina. Now, therefore,
Be it resolved by the House of Representatives, the Senate concurring:
That the members of the South Carolina General Assembly, by this resolution, commend and congratulate the Aiken Technical College Knights Basketball Team and its coaching staff on winning both the 2000 National Junior College Athletic Association Division II Region 10 Championship, and the 2000 National Junior College Athletic Association Division II District 7 Championship, and on receiving an invitation to compete in the National Junior College Athletic Association Division II National Tournament in Danville, Illinois.
Be it further resolved that a copy of this resolution be presented to the Aiken Technical College Knights Basketball Team and its Head Coach, Charles Welch.
